How is CDI Rate defined in a legal contract?
- CDI Rate means the Brazilian interbank deposit rate or Certificado de Depósito Interbancário. This rate is an average of the interbank overnight rates. Seen in 8 SEC filings
- CDI Rate means the Brazilian interbank deposit rate, alternatively known as the Certificado de Depósito Interbancário, which is an average calculated from overnight rates. Seen in 6 SEC filings
- CDI Rate means in reference to the adjustment of any amount on a certain date of determination, the percentage which corresponds to the variation of the Brazilian interbank rate for 1-day certificate of deposits (CDI). This percentage is calculated by a particular [organization]. Seen in 3 SEC filings
- CDI Rate means the daily average rate of the DI – Depósitos Interfinanceiros of one day, expressed in the form of a percentage per annum, which is calculated and published daily by a specific [organization]. Seen in 2 SEC filings
- CDI Rate means the Brazilian Interbank Deposit Rate, also known as the Certificado de Depósito Interbancário (CDI). Seen in 1 SEC filing
